Analysis
Aruba recorded 2.73 kt for energy — emissions (co2eq) from n2o in 2023.
The figure is up 5.1% on the previous year and up 31.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, energy — emissions (co2eq) from n2o in Aruba peaked at 3.55 kt in 1999 and was at its lowest, 0.0798 kt, in 1961.
Aruba ranks 180th of 199 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
